/**
* Action token handler for verification of e-mail address.
* @author hmlnarik
*/
public class IdpVerifyAccountLinkActionTokenHandler extends AbstractActionTokenHandler<IdpVerifyAccountLinkActionToken> {
public IdpVerifyAccountLinkActionTokenHandler() {
super(
IdpVerifyAccountLinkActionToken.TOKEN_TYPE,
IdpVerifyAccountLinkActionToken.class,
Messages.STALE_CODE,
EventType.IDENTITY_PROVIDER_LINK_ACCOUNT,
Errors.INVALID_TOKEN
);
}
@Override
public Predicate<? super IdpVerifyAccountLinkActionToken>[] getVerifiers(ActionTokenContext<IdpVerifyAccountLinkActionToken> tokenContext) {
return TokenUtils.predicates(
verifyEmail(tokenContext)
);
}
@Override
public Response handleToken(IdpVerifyAccountLinkActionToken token, ActionTokenContext<IdpVerifyAccountLinkActionToken> tokenContext) {
UserModel user = tokenContext.getAuthenticationSession().getAuthenticatedUser();
EventBuilder event = tokenContext.getEvent();
final UriInfo uriInfo = tokenContext.getUriInfo();
final RealmModel realm = tokenContext.getRealm();
final KeycloakSession session = tokenContext.getSession();
event.event(EventType.IDENTITY_PROVIDER_LINK_ACCOUNT)
.detail(Details.EMAIL, user.getEmail())
.detail(Details.IDENTITY_PROVIDER, token.getIdentityProviderAlias())
.detail(Details.IDENTITY_PROVIDER_USERNAME, token.getIdentityProviderUsername())
.success();
AuthenticationSessionModel authSession = tokenContext.getAuthenticationSession();
if (tokenContext.isAuthenticationSessionFresh()) {
token.setOriginalCompoundAuthenticationSessionId(token.getCompoundAuthenticationSessionId());
String authSessionEncodedId = AuthenticationSessionCompoundId.fromAuthSession(authSession).getEncodedId();
token.setCompoundAuthenticationSessionId(authSessionEncodedId);
UriBuilder builder = Urls.actionTokenBuilder(uriInfo.getBaseUri(), token.serialize(session, realm, uriInfo),
authSession.getClient().getClientId(), authSession.getTabId());
String confirmUri = builder.build(realm.getName()).toString();
return session.getProvider(LoginFormsProvider.class)
.setAuthenticationSession(authSession)
.setSuccess(Messages.CONFIRM_ACCOUNT_LINKING, token.getIdentityProviderUsername(), token.getIdentityProviderAlias())
.setAttribute(Constants.TEMPLATE_ATTR_ACTION_URI, confirmUri)
.createInfoPage();
}
// verify user email as we know it is valid as this entry point would never have gotten here.
user.setEmailVerified(true);
if (token.getOriginalCompoundAuthenticationSessionId() != null) {
AuthenticationSessionManager asm = new AuthenticationSessionManager(session);
asm.removeAuthenticationSession(realm, authSession, true);
AuthenticationSessionCompoundId compoundId = AuthenticationSessionCompoundId.encoded(token.getOriginalCompoundAuthenticationSessionId());
ClientModel originalClient = realm.getClientById(compoundId.getClientUUID());
authSession = asm.getAuthenticationSessionByIdAndClient(realm, compoundId.getRootSessionId(), originalClient, compoundId.getTabId());
if (authSession != null) {
authSession.setAuthNote(IdpEmailVerificationAuthenticator.VERIFY_ACCOUNT_IDP_USERNAME, token.getIdentityProviderUsername());
} else {
session.authenticationSessions().updateNonlocalSessionAuthNotes(
compoundId,
Collections.singletonMap(IdpEmailVerificationAuthenticator.VERIFY_ACCOUNT_IDP_USERNAME, token.getIdentityProviderUsername())
);
}
return session.getProvider(LoginFormsProvider.class)
.setAuthenticationSession(authSession)
.setSuccess(Messages.IDENTITY_PROVIDER_LINK_SUCCESS, token.getIdentityProviderAlias(), token.getIdentityProviderUsername())
.setAttribute(Constants.SKIP_LINK, true)
.createInfoPage();
}
authSession.setAuthNote(IdpEmailVerificationAuthenticator.VERIFY_ACCOUNT_IDP_USERNAME, token.getIdentityProviderUsername());
return tokenContext.brokerFlow(null, null, authSession.getAuthNote(AuthenticationProcessor.CURRENT_FLOW_PATH));
}
}
